Essential Experience Highlights for a Strong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airer Resume
- Diagnose and repair electrical and mechanical issues in hand and portable power tools using multimeters, oscilloscopes, and other diagnostic equipment.
- Disassemble and assemble tools for repair and maintenance, ensuring proper alignment and functionality.
- Replace defective components, including motors, gears, switches, and bearings.
- Lubricate and adjust tools to maintain optimal performance and extend lifespan.
- Perform preventive maintenance on tools to minimize the risk of breakdowns and failures.
- Calibrate tools according to manufacturer specifications and industry standards.
- Document repair procedures and keep records of maintenance activities.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airer
What are the key skills required to be a successful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airer?
The key skills required to be a successful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airer include electrical and mechanical troubleshooting, tool disassembly and assembly, component replacement, lubrication, adjustment, preventive maintenance, calibration, and documentation.
What are the common challenges faced by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ers?
The common challenges faced by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ers include diagnosing complex electrical and mechanical issues, working with a variety of tools, and maintaining a high level of accuracy and precision in their work.
What are the career prospects for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ers?
The career prospects for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ers are generally positive, with a growing demand for skilled technicians in this field.
What are the safety precautions that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ers should follow?
The safety precautions that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ers should follow include wearing appropriate personal protective equipment, using tools and equipment correctly, and following established safety procedures.

What are the different types of hand and portable power tools that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ers work on?
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ers work on a variety of hand and portable power tools, including drills, saws, grinders, and nailers.
What are the different industries that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ers work in?
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ers work in a variety of industries, including construction, manufacturing, and automotive repair.
What are the different career paths available to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ers?
Hand and Portable Power Tool Repairers can advance their careers by becoming supervisors, managers, or trainers.
